学习MySQL是否需要搭建云环境?
结论:学习MySQL不必须搭建云环境,但云环境能提供更接近生产环境的实践体验,适合有一定基础或需要模拟真实场景的学习者。
本地环境 vs. 云环境的对比
1. 本地环境的优势
- 简单快捷:在个人电脑上安装MySQL(如使用XAMPP、Docker或直接下载社区版)即可开始学习,无需额外成本。
- 适合初学者:基础SQL语法、表操作、查询优化等内容完全可以在本地完成,无需复杂配置。
- 离线可用:不依赖网络,适合随时随地练习。
2. 云环境的优势
- 更接近生产环境:云服务器(如AWS RDS、阿里云RDS)的配置、权限管理和高可用架构与真实企业环境一致。
- 学习运维技能:通过云平台可以实践备份恢复、主从复制、性能监控等进阶内容。
- 团队协作:云数据库便于多人共享,适合项目协作或远程学习。
何时建议使用云环境?
- 需要模拟企业级数据库管理(如分库分表、读写分离)。
- 计划考取云计算认证(如AWS/Aliyun的数据库相关认证)。
- 预算允许:云服务器通常按需付费,但长期使用可能产生费用。
核心建议
- 新手优先本地学习:先用本地MySQL(如MySQL Workbench)掌握基础,再考虑云环境。
- 进阶者尝试云服务:通过云厂商的免费试用(如AWS Free Tier、阿里云学生机)低成本体验生产级MySQL。
总结
云环境并非学习MySQL的必要条件,但它是从“理论”到“实战”的重要桥梁。先夯实本地基础,再逐步过渡到云平台,是更高效的学习路径。
CLOUD云计算